## Tuning the baseline file

Lintharbor's baseline (`baseline.toml`) suppresses pre-existing findings so CI only fails on new ones. Keep it small: entries expire, and stale suppressions get pruned on every release branch cut. If the baseline grows past the cap, the build warns and eventually blocks. Don't edit expiry dates by hand. Thresholds and expiry windows are set by the constants below.

tuning table, yajog-yahof:
BUDGETS = {
    "lamvan": 303,
    "wenox": 460,
    "fenvan": 525,
}

## Who to ping about GiftNote

Welcome aboard! GiftNote is our donation-receipt mailer for the Larchfield Fund. Template tweaks go to the comms folks; delivery failures and bounce weirdness go to the platform crew. Don't push template changes on Fridays — receipts batch over the weekend. For anything GiftNote-related, start with the address below.

billing contact of kaweg-tajeg = drudor.lamion.oliath@torvalabs.test

// Constants for the Quillstat metrics-aggregation sidecar.
//
// Plugin authors: the sidecar batches samples from your plugin,
// flushes on either a size or time threshold, and sheds load when
// the buffer high-water mark is hit. Do not assume flush ordering
// across batches. Overriding these values voids our latency
// guarantees, so treat them as read-only. Current defaults follow.

constants for bawif-kawif:
QUOTAS = {
    "ulaael": 5,
    "holael": 10,
}

Subject: Marketing spend trim for Q4

Team — quick heads-up before Friday's review. We're cutting the Brightmere marketing budget by 15% for Q4, mostly paid channels and the Lakeshore event sponsorship. Product launch funds for Quillet stay intact. Finance will reissue cost-centre allocations next week. Nothing dramatic, just tightening ahead of year-end. The note below covers where this fits in the bigger plan.

board note of bawep-tajef: Queniusek Systems plans to raise the Quenvan list price by 53.1 percent in March. The pricing group signed off on a budget of $176.4 million for Project Drueth. The renewal with Casionix Partners closes at $142.5 million a year, 8.3 percent below the last contract. Project Fraax slips by six weeks because of the tooling delay.